VMware,作为全球领先的虚拟化解决方案提供商,其产品在提高资源利用率、降低成本及增强业务灵活性方面发挥了巨大作用
然而,随着虚拟化环境的不断扩展和数据流量的急剧增加,网络性能成为制约虚拟化应用效能的关键因素之一
为了应对这一挑战,VMware虚拟机端口聚合技术应运而生,它不仅能够有效提升网络带宽,还能增强网络的可靠性和容错能力
本文将深入探讨VMware虚拟机端口聚合的原理、实施步骤、优势以及最佳实践,旨在为企业IT管理者提供一套全面而有力的指导方案
一、VMware虚拟机端口聚合概述 端口聚合,也称为链路聚合或NIC绑定(Network Interface Card Bonding),是一种将多个物理网络接口组合成一个逻辑接口的技术
在VMware虚拟化环境中,这一技术被广泛应用于vSphere平台,通过vSwitch(虚拟交换机)实现虚拟机网络流量的负载均衡和故障转移
其核心理念在于,通过将多个物理网络适配器(vNICs)绑定在一起,形成一个更宽、更可靠的虚拟网络通道,从而显著提升数据传输效率和网络可用性
二、VMware虚拟机端口聚合的工作原理 VMware虚拟机端口聚合主要通过vSphere的vNetwork Distributed Switch(vDS)或vSphere Standard Switch(vSS)实现,但vDS因其高级功能和扩展性更受青睐
聚合模式通常包括以下几种: 1.负载均衡(Load Balancing):根据预设的策略(如基于源MAC、目的MAC、IP哈希等),将网络流量均匀分配到绑定的多个vNICs上,以实现带宽的充分利用
2.故障转移(Failover):当其中一个vNIC发生故障时,流量将自动重定向到其他活跃的vNIC上,确保网络连接的连续性
3.主动-备用(Active-Standby):在所有绑定的vNICs中,只有一个处于活动状态,其余作为备用
当活动vNIC失效时,备用vNIC立即接管,虽然这种模式不增加带宽,但提供了最高的冗余度
4.LACP(Link Aggregation Control Protocol):基于IEEE 802.3ad标准的链路聚合控制协议,允许vSwitch与物理交换机协商建立聚合组,实现更智能的链路管理和故障检测
三、实施步骤 实施VMware虚拟机端口聚合的过程大致分为以下几个步骤: 1.评估需求:根据虚拟化环境的规模、网络流量特性及冗余需求,选择合适的聚合模式和策略
2.配置vDS或vSS:在vSphere Client中,创建或编辑vDS/vSS,并启用端口聚合功能
3.绑定vNICs:选择目标虚拟机,将其网络接口(vNIC)绑定到先前配置的聚合组
4.配置物理交换机:确保物理网络交换机支持并正确配置了相应的端口聚合协议(如LACP),以匹配vSphere的设置
5.测试与验证:实施后,进行网络性能测试,包括带宽、延迟和故障转移能力,确保聚合配置达到预期效果
四、优势分析 VMware虚拟机端口聚合技术的实施带来了多方面的显著优势: - 性能提升:通过多路径传输,显著增加了网络带宽,降低了延迟,适用于大数据传输、实时通信等高带宽需求场景
- 高可用性:提供故障转移机制,即使单个物理链路或网卡故障,也能保证网络服务的连续性,提升系统整体可靠性
- 简化管理:将多个物理接口统一管理为一个逻辑接口,简化了网络配置和维护工作,降低了管理复杂度
- 成本效益:虽然初期可能需要增加一些硬件资源(如额外的网卡),但长期来看,通过提高资源利用率和减少因网络中断导致的业务损失,具有显著的成本节约效果
五、最佳实践 为了最大化VMware虚拟机端口聚合的效果,以下是一些最佳实践建议: - 合理规划:在设计阶段充分考虑未来扩展性,避免聚合组成为性能瓶颈
- 监控与调优:持续监控网络性能,根据实际需求调整负载均衡策略和聚合模式
- 兼容性验证:确保所有网络设备(包括物理交换机、路由器及虚拟化平台)均支持并正确配置了所使用的聚合协议
- 安全考虑:虽然端口聚合本身不直接涉及安全问题,但应确保聚合后的网络环境依然符合企业的安全政策和标准
- 文档记录:详细记录聚合配置和测试结果,便于后续维护和故障排查
六、结语 VMware虚拟机端口聚合技术作为提升虚拟化环境网络性能和高可用性的有效手段,正逐渐成为企业IT架构优化不可或缺的一部分
通过深入理解其工作原理、科学规划实施步骤、充分利用其优势并遵循最佳实践,企业不仅能够显著提升网络效能,还能增强业务连续性和竞争力
随着技术的不断进步和应用场景的持续拓展,VMware虚拟机端口聚合将继续在推动企业数字化转型中发挥关键作用